Abingdon Health is a world leading developer and manufacturer of high-quality rapid tests across all industry sectors, including healthcare and COVID-19.

We take projects from initial concept through to routine and large-scale manufacturing and have also developed and marketed our own labelled tests.


We offer product development, regulatory support, technology transfer and manufacturing services for customers looking to develop new assays or transfer existing laboratory-based assays to a lateral flow format.

Abingdon Health has also developed AppDx, a customisable image capturing technology that transforms a smartphone into a self-sufficient, standalone lateral-flow reader.

The Role


This role is within the QARA team and is responsible for providing regulatory support for products that are manufactured and/or marketed by the Company and provide project coordination and support for clients of Abingdon Health's Regulatory Service.


The role responsibilities:


  • Updating and maintenance of databases and licences held by Abingdon Health.
  • Preparation, submission and tracking of documents (such as Dossiers, Product Information Files, Technical Files and artworks) for regulatory submissions. (FDA, CE, UKCA)
  • Conducting post market surveillance
  • Provide ongoing regulatory advice to project teams throughout product and process development, ensuring regulatory concerns are planned and accounted for and the relevant data generated to meet project objectives.
  • Coordinate projects for clients of the regulatory consultancy service.
  • Managing the project plans to ensure delivery, including working with multiple internal stakeholders/departments
  • Coordinating, running and minuting of project meetings
  • Management of project document in line with organizational procedures
  • Communicating with customers throughout the project lifecycle
  • Assist in external audits (BSI, FDA, MDSAP) and/or regulatory inspections.
  • Building relationships with internal and external stakeholders (including Notified Bodies) using best practice
  • Assist in correspondence with regulatory agencies, auditing organisations, and notified bodies and respond to quality deficiencies; to produce/update documents related to compliance to the respective standards.
